Javascript 有没有办法通过URL激活引导选项卡?

Javascript 有没有办法通过URL激活引导选项卡?,javascript,twitter-bootstrap,Javascript,Twitter Bootstrap,我用的是BootStrap的标签。有没有一种方法可以让你在访问example.com/8时看到标记为8的选项卡 当前代码: <!-- Nav tabs --> <ul class="nav nav-tabs" id="MyTabs"> <li><a href="#8" data-toggle="tab">8</a></li> <li><a href="#7" data-toggle="tab">

我用的是BootStrap的标签。有没有一种方法可以让你在访问example.com/8时看到标记为8的选项卡

当前代码:

<!-- Nav tabs -->
<ul class="nav nav-tabs" id="MyTabs">
  <li><a href="#8" data-toggle="tab">8</a></li>
  <li><a href="#7" data-toggle="tab">7</a></li>
  <li><a href="#6" data-toggle="tab">6</a></li>
  <li><a href="#5" data-toggle="tab">5</a></li>
  <li><a href="#4" data-toggle="tab">4</a></li>
</ul>
<!-- Tab panes -->
<div class="tab-content">
...
</div>
我通常不使用JS,因为我还没有学会它,但任何帮助都会很棒

// Javascript to enable link to tab
var url = document.location.toString();
if (url.match('#')) {
    $('.nav-tabs a[href=#'+url.split('#')[1]+']').tab('show') ;
} 

// Change hash for page-reload
$('.nav-tabs a').on('shown', function (e) {
    window.location.hash = e.target.hash;
})

From:但我建议你将来尝试自己的研究。我将使用类似于

OMG!非常感谢!虽然谷歌搜索会起作用,但我发现这更有效。谢谢。@DavidMulder抱歉,如果它是重复的,我没有时间查找其他类似的内容。是的,我花了几分钟时间